What Are Cobots?
Cobots are a type of robotic technology developed to interact safely and effectively with human workers in a shared workspace. Differing from traditional industrial robots that often require safety cages, cobots are fitted with advanced sensors and AI capabilities that enable them to understand and adapt to their environment. This makes them suitable for a assortment of tasks in a dynamic warehouse setting, including picking, packing, palletizing, and sorting.
Key Benefits of Implementing Cobots
Cobots can produce a fast return on investment in many warehouse or fulfillment operations by boosting productivity and reducing costs. Some key advantages are:
- Increased Productivity: Cobots can work continuously without fatigue, allowing them to manage repetitive tasks at a consistent pace. This increases overall throughput and enables human workers to concentrate on more critical or complex operations that require human intervention and decision-making skills.
- Enhanced Accuracy and Reduced Waste: With exact handling and advanced programming, cobots decrease errors in tasks such as inventory and picking. This accuracy aids in decreasing waste linked to returns and mis-picks, thereby saving costs and boosting customer satisfaction.
- Scalability and Flexibility: Cobots are effortlessly programmable and can be swiftly reconfigured to adjust to changing warehouse layouts or operational demands. This flexibility makes them a valuable asset, especially in industries facing varying consumer trends or seasonal fluctuations.
- Improved Worker Safety: By taking on physically demanding or ergonomically unfavorable tasks, cobots lower the risk of injuries among the workforce. This not only boosts safety but also reduces downtime and associated costs from worker compensation claims.
- Seamless Integration: Cobots can be integrated into existing warehouse management systems (WMS) and en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, facilitating smooth data exchange and communication. This integration helps in optimizing inventory management and streamlining the supply chain.
Implementing Cobots in Warehouse Operations
To effectively deploy cobots in warehouse settings, businesses should consider the following steps:
- Recognize Opportunities for Automation: Carry out a in-depth analysis of warehouse operations to identify repetitive, time-consuming tasks that are suitable for automation. Common areas include order picking, product sorting, and packaging.
- Choose the Right Cobot: Select a cobot that best suits the identified tasks. Assess factors such as reach, speed, payload capacity, and compatibility with existing systems.
- Plan for Human-Cobot Collaboration: Create workflows that enhance the strengths of both human workers and cobots. Make sure that employees are instructed to work alongside cobots, emphasizing teamwork and efficiency.
- Test and Optimize: Launch a pilot program to test the cobots in real-world scenarios. Monitor performance and collect feedback from workers to adjust operations and address any issues.
- Scale Gradually: Once the pilot program proves successful, progressively scale up the deployment of cobots across other areas of the warehouse. Continuous monitoring and adaptation are key to maximizing the benefits of cobot integration.
